MUHAMMED LAWAL SHUAIBU, J.C.A. (Delivering the Leading Judgment): This appeal is against the judgment of the Federal High Court, sitting in Lagos, Coram Honourable Justice C. A. Obiozor delivered on the 28th of June, 2019 upholding the appeal of the respondent against an earlier judgment of the Tax Appeal Tribunal. At page 375 of the record of appeal, learned judge of the lower Court (sitting on appeal against the judgment of the Tax Appeal Tribunal) held as follows:-
“From the records the tax became due for payment in August, 2007. The conduct of the respondents in withholding payment for some two years amounted to grave invidious and despicable machination aimed at short changing the Nigerian nation of its revenue. The pretentious claim to objection is more than a clear and obtrusive contrivance, so infamously contrived to justify the deliberate refusal to pay accrued Education Tax for 2006 as due, and I so hold.
